METHOD FOR FINELY DISPERSING INORGANIC FINE PARTICLE IN DISPERSION, COATING LIQUID FOR INK RECEIVING LAYER AND INKJET RECORDING BODY

PROBLEM TO BE SOLVED: To provide a method for finely dispersing a pigment capable of optimizing the quality of printing, and an inkjet recording body having an ink receiving layer formed by applying a finely dispersing liquid obtained by the method, and having a high printing density, being excellent in surface smoothness, the quality of printing and ink water resistance, being capable of outputting an image with a high resolution being equal to a silver salt photograph.;SOLUTION: The method for finely dispersing the inorganic particulate in the dispersion is characterized by finely dispersing the dispersion of the inorganic fine particle by facing and making the dispersion of the inorganic particulate collide at least at two or more sites in a flow path for the dispersion through an orifice with a minimum flow path area of ≥0.1 mm2 within a range of pressure 20-300 MPa.;COPYRIGHT: (C)2006,JPO&NCIPI
